Цель заброшена
Автор не отписывался в цели 6 лет 2 месяца 21 день
Многопоточность в iOS (Swift)
Если вы хотите дать своему пользователю эффективное и быстрое приложение на ios, то без многопоточности вам точно не обойтись. В курсе мы познакомимся с многопоточностью, начиная от самых низкоуровневых примитивов и заканчивая высокоуровневыми абстракциями. Мы рассмотрим практически все способы многопоточного программирования, в том числе малоизвестные.
В курсе вас ждут лекции, тесты, задачи, полезные материалы — все что нужно, чтобы разобраться!
И, конечно же, вы сможете поработать с кодом, который будет использован в курсе.
Уверены, что каждый участник почерпнет для себя что-то новое.
Критерий завершения
Пройти курс
-
Multithreading
-
Введение
-
Базовые понятия
-
Quality of service
-
Synchronization
-
Recursive lock
-
Condition
-
Read write lock
-
Spin lock
-
Synchronized
-
Problems
-
Atomic operations
-
-
GCD (Grand Central Dispatch)
-
Введение
-
Очереди
-
Methods
-
Concurrent perform
-
Work item
-
Semaphore
-
Dispatch group
-
Dispatch barrier
-
Dispatch source
-
Target queue hierarchy
-
Dispatch IO
-
-
Operation
-
Введение
-
Operation
-
Operation и Operation Queue
-
Async operation
-
maxConcurrentOperationCount
-
Cancel operation
-
Dependencies
-
waitUntil
-
Completion Block
-
Suspend
-
GCD VS Operation
-
Заключение
-
- 3090
- 17 августа 2018, 04:29
Не пропустите новые записи!
Подпишитесь на цель и следите за ее достижением